Transaction 939c96edff686a21efb5d26f5e7103eac982705dd48680e91c319d46aa2d5236

1 Input
2 Outputs
  • 939c96edff686a21efb5d26f5e7103eac982705dd48680e91c319d46aa2d5236:0
  • value  80432143
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C
  • 939c96edff686a21efb5d26f5e7103eac982705dd48680e91c319d46aa2d5236:1
  • value  654570
    address  397C8zTZKmc3bi861xhwgqxQejgr8Qw4Y4